FX54 XDJ is a 2004 Ford Ka in Red with a 1,299cc petrol engine. This vehicle has been through 14 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 78.6%.
Across all 2004 Ford Ka models, the average MOT pass rate is 67.3% with a typical mileage of 45,689 miles. This particular vehicle has performed better than the average for its year.
The most common reason a Ford Ka fails its MOT is suspension component mounting prescribed area is excessively corroded, accounting for 404,005 recorded failures. If you're considering buying FX54 XDJ,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Ford Ka typically stays on UK roads for around 29 years. At 22 years old, this Ford Ka is well into its expected lifespan but still has years ahead.
